Wish there was an option or button to turn off KDE connect when I'm outside my house

[–] TheAgeOfSuperboredom@lemmy.ca 10 points 1 year ago (1 children)

There's a "Trusted Networks" setting to limit autodiscovery to certain networks. I don't think it'll completely disable the software, but it should prevent your phone from being visible to others.
